How they compare
Cambodia currently reports 16.14 t CO2eq/ha against 12.63 t CO2eq/ha in China, Hong Kong SAR, a difference of 3.51 t CO2eq/ha.
That makes Cambodia's figure about 1.3 times China, Hong Kong SAR's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was China, Hong Kong SAR ahead.
Cambodia ranks 13th and China, Hong Kong SAR ranks 20th of 221 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Cambodia averaged higher in 2 and China, Hong Kong SAR in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cambodia | China, Hong Kong SAR |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 5.41 t CO2eq/ha | 7.51 t CO2eq/ha | 2.1 t CO2eq/ha | China, Hong Kong SAR |
| 2000s | 5.51 t CO2eq/ha | 8.45 t CO2eq/ha | 2.94 t CO2eq/ha | China, Hong Kong SAR |
| 2010s | 16.58 t CO2eq/ha | 9.98 t CO2eq/ha | 6.59 t CO2eq/ha | Cambodia |
| 2020s | 15.07 t CO2eq/ha | 12.66 t CO2eq/ha | 2.4 t CO2eq/ha | Cambodia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ions indicators disseminates indicators on sectoral shares of total national gre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ions as well as three indicators of emissions intensity: per capita emissions; emissions per value of agricultural production; and emissions per area of agricultural land.
